The Vanecourt dispatch simulator exposes a plugin interface for custom scheduling strategies, and plugin authors should understand the core event loop before implementing one. In particular, hall-call batching, cab reassignment, and the penalty model for long waits all interact in non-obvious ways, and naive plugins often starve upper floors. We recommend reading the strategy lifecycle notes and the worked examples first, then studying the reference round-robin plugin. All of these materials are collected on our internal documentation page.

operations page: https://jira.zemvarlabs.internal/browse/pages/pages/projects

## Configuration

Quartzpage rebuilds only pages whose content hash changed since the last deploy. Full rebuilds are rare; escalate if one takes over ten minutes. Set `REBUILD_MODE=incremental` and `CACHE_DIR=/var/quartz/cache`. Stale pages usually mean the hash index is corrupt — clear the cache and redeploy. The rebuild worker also authenticates against the Lornbeck asset store, so add this line to the environment file:

sealed setting: ARCHIVE_KEY3=8d0

Effective Monday, the Calloway Annexe reception desk moves from level 3 to the ground floor, beside the east stairwell. All visitors sign in there; do not escort guests upstairs unsigned. Assistants collecting visitors should use the ground-floor vestibule door rather than the lift lobby. That vestibule door is keypad-controlled and opens with the code below.

door code, yagap-bahof: bdg-O-05